How to reformat a computer that was previously connected to the network?

original title: change the network to stand alone

We acquire some computers that were on a network: the network no longer exists and we want to use in the State current alones. We have we anything apart from Windows and Office CD that we have, that is all the drivers because they were thought to be on the server.  Any help would be appreciated

Simply reinstall Windows and Office from the CD you have.  The fact that they used to be on a network does not come into play.  Once installed, you can go to windowsupdate.microsoft.com to install updates that are necessary for your computer or see the website of the manufacturer for updated drivers.

  • Activate Windows XP on a computer that is not connected to the network

    I have a machine that is not connected and I have to activate the XP software.  It is supposed to be a phone number on the activation window that appears, but there is not - does anyone know what number to call to get this activated machine before it expires?  Any help is appreciated.

    This Help article How to activate Windows XP and Microsoft Help support?

    How do to activate Windows XP by phone to contact a Microsoft customer service representative to activate Windows by phone, follow these steps:

    1. Click Start , point to programs , point to Accessories , point to System Tools and then click Activate Windows .

      Or, click on the Activation of Windows icon in the notification area

    2. Click on Yes, I want to telephone a customer the service representative to active windows now .
    3. Click read the Windows Product Activation privacy statement , click new , and then click Next .
    4. Follow the steps in the Activate Windows by phone dialog box, and then click Next .

      Note The number appears now and differs based on the location you select.

    5. When activation is completed and you receive the following message appears, click OK .
      You have activated your copy of Windows.

  • Install and run Adobe animate on a computer that is not connected to the internet

    I am running Creative Suite 5 on my computer graphics. This computer is not connected to the internet for security reasons. I want to upgrade to Adobe animate but I am confused how the creative cloud software works. What I must be connected to the internet to install and run this new software? Y at - it an option to install and run this software on a computer that is not connected to the internet?

    I appreciate any comments on this issue.

    Thank you.

    CC needs you to be online:

    1. When you turn it on for the first time

    2. once in 90 days, you need to be online to keep the active CC.

    The rest of the time, you can use it as desktop CC without any internet connect product.

  • I'm trying to install Acrobat 8 Std on a laptop computer that was in need of a restoration.  He asks the file AdobePDF.dll since my Vista CD - I do not have.  How can I get this file or another which will allow my Acrobat 8 work on this laptop with Win 8

    I'm trying to install Acrobat 8 Std on a laptop computer that was in need of a restoration.  He asks the file AdobePDF.dll since my Vista CD - I do not have.  How can I get this file or another which will allow my Acrobat 8 work on this laptop with Win 8.1, which she did before restoring?

    John,

    AdobePDF.dll is in the file Data1.cab. Mine is located in C:\Program Files (x 86) \Adobe\Acrobat8\Adobe Acrobat 8 Professional\ You need to extract the file "AdobePDF.dll_64" from the .cab file. You can do this with WinZip or 7-Zip. Everything you need to extract is this file, nothing else... Once you have extracted it, remove the _64, so the name of the file is AdobePDF.dll. Then place the file in any location you want and run the program it when asked. For a file location, I suggest to C:\Program Files (x 86) \Adobe\Acrobat8\
